Transaction ac50288f95400cad4094de66ce2476c464849bcdd38425027279c6a14e562148

1 Input
2 Outputs
  • ac50288f95400cad4094de66ce2476c464849bcdd38425027279c6a14e562148:0
  • value  150000
    address  1CUqbCkHhaZxLhzciH26qZdWFjmbYpzpFi
  • ac50288f95400cad4094de66ce2476c464849bcdd38425027279c6a14e562148:1
  • value  14043906
    address  3AEyiSpM1ieeWU5G4GbxStpBimSjEvpM8X